James Dean Signed High School Graduation Yearbook (1949). Vintage original gold hardback Fairmount High School yearbook. James Dean graduated from Fairmount High School in Fairmount, Indiana in 1949. During his time in high school, he participated in sports and drama, and was also known for his love of cars. One of his greatest achievements in high school was winning a public speaking contest in 1949, which earned him a trip to California to compete in the national finals. He also played basketball and baseball and acted in several school plays. After high school, James Dean attended Santa Monica College in California for one semester before dropping out to pursue his acting career full-time. Despite his brief time in college, he continued to study acting and was eventually accepted into the prestigious Actors Studio in New York City. James Dean went on to become a cultural icon and a legendary actor, known for his performances in films such as Rebel Without a Cause, Giant, and East of Eden. He is considered one of the most talented actors of his generation, and his untimely death at the age of 24 only added to his mystique and legend. Dean signed above his portrait on the debate club page. He is also pictured in the Boris Karloff-inspired Frankenstein monster make-up for an appearance at a Halloween carnival held at the high school. The book is also signed by Dean's classmates on various pages. Autograph is being sold as is without warranty. Yearbook measures approx. 8.75" × 11.25".
